Four. Burner deflection technology

aa 1800c
Our burner defection technology can be only applied on our flame model machine (AA-1800F,AA-1800C,AA-1800D);
When customer testing high concentration elements, the burner’s angle can be adjusted to reduce the value of the absorbance.
By using this technology,you can test the maximum concentration of 20 times, and it is not easy to affected by the dilution errors, elements pollution of the containers and reagents.

Seven. Graphite furnace light control heating

aa 1800c
Multiple graphite furnace heating methods.
Electronic control heating: For conventional or low -temperature elements,our
company uses unique power heating method,built-in temperature curve,more accurate to eliminate interference factors.
Time control heating: For some high-temperature elements, you can choose time control temperature,0.5s,1s and 1.5s can be set.
Light control heating: Light control heating can directly monitor the inner wall temperature of the graphite tube,which is closer to the sample,and also make the heating more smoother and more stable.Other companies basically detect the temperature of the outer wall, but the value of the inner wall is more accurate and effective, and more closer and accurate to detect the sample. It is also built-in curves between light intensity and temperature.
It is our patented technology.

Eight. Two background correction functions

D2 method (deuterium lamp method) and SR method (high speed self-absorption method) two background correction methods.
D2 method (deuterium lamp method):It is suitable for environmental water, pure water, tap water and other relatively simple body samples;
SR method (high-speed self-absorption method): It is suitable for food and other body samples which are relatively complex and contain a large number of interfering elements.

Eleven. Several types graphite tubes

aa 1800c
High-density graphite tube: ordinary tube,the advantage is  that is can test low-temperature elements that are easy to oxidize; For example: Cd,Pb,Na,K,Zn,Mg
Platform pyrolytic coated graphite tube: good comprehensive performance, standard configuration,suitable for complex samples, for example: biological samples,discharge water,seawater;
Non-platfrom pyrolytic coated graphite tube: high temperature tube, suitable for high temperature element detection;
Special coating graphite tube: tungsten coated tube, mainly test silicon; Zirconium-coated tube, mainly test aluminum.

After carefully unpacking the contents, check the materials with the packing list (page 4) to ensure that you have received everything in good condition.

Place the instrument in a suitable location away from direct sunlight.  In order to have the best performance from your instrument, keep it as far as possible from any strong magnetic or electrical fields or any electrical device that may generate high-frequency fields. Set the unit up in an area that is free of dust, corrosive gases and strong vibrations.

Remove any obstructions or materials that could hinder the flow of air under and around the instrument.

Use the appropriate power cord and plug into a grounded outlet.

Turn on your spectrophotometer. Allow it to warm up for 15 minutes before taking any readings. We suggest you then do the Calibrate System with the Search 656.1nm to set the wavelength to the deuterium lamp emission line.
